Title: Kilian Barth: Innovator in Sensor Technology
Introduction
Kilian Barth is a notable inventor based in Forbach, Germany. He has made significant contributions to the field of sensor technology, holding 2 patents that showcase his innovative approach to contactless distance measuring and operational settings in measuring devices.
Latest Patents
One of Barth's latest patents is a sensor system for contactless distance measuring. This system allows for the measurement of distance between a sensor body and an object without physical contact. The sensor body includes an identification resistor, whose resistance value can be interrogated by a control unit located externally. This setup enables the control unit to determine the status of the electrical connection, generating an alarm signal if the connection is interrupted, thus preventing faulty positioning of the sensor body.
Another significant patent by Barth involves a measuring device and method for its operational setting. This device measures a geometrical variable using a sensor fed by a regulated, phase-dependent current source. The system superimposes an alternating supply voltage and an alternating measuring voltage, allowing for the adjustment of the characteristic relationship between the measuring voltage and the geometrical variable to match a prescribed characteristic curve.
Career Highlights
Throughout his career, Kilian Barth has worked with several prominent companies, including Precitec GmbH and C.A. Weidmüller GmbH & Co. His experience in these organizations has contributed to his expertise in sensor technology and innovation.
